Bet the flop. You opened big pre- and got one caller. Great.

Also a great flop. You obviously want to play as big a pot as possible. What makes you think checking the flop makes this more likely to happen than betting out? Yes, you can create some scenarios where he'll call a turn bet with a hand that would fold to a flop bet. But the likelihood of getting a second street of value from those hands is fairly low, so it seems like you're not giving up a lot of potential value, if any, while not affording yourself the chance to get 3 streets worth when he has enough for that to happen may well give up more even after factoring relative frequency.

Bet the flop. You're not going to win a good sized pot if your opponent doesn't have something that they will call with. Maybe you induce one flop bluff, but that's it. You also risk giving free cards, etc...

Any ways, bet more on the turn and bet all rivers.

if you not betting the flop ( which is ok to do when we smash the deck this hard) we need to be bombing the turn

i dont like checking back this texture but if it was super dry like A83 rainbow i like it more bc we don't worry about giving free equity to draws on this type of board as much ( people generally fold 24, 25 type hands)
